Upcoming Trends and Scope Of the Fantasy Sports Industry in 2023

The number of people who participate in fantasy sports has increased significantly over the past several years, going from just 5,00,000 in 1988 to more than 56.8 million in Canada and the United States alone. Fantasy sports undoubtedly generates millions of dollars, and its ecosystem includes elements like online participation, sponsorships, draught parties, merchandise, real-world game tickets, brand promotion, etc. Fantasy sports players are the biggest and most effective influences because they boost the appeal of their real-game equivalents. 

The fantasy sports sector, supported by ongoing technological improvements, is seen as one of the key drivers that can help turn casual sports fans into avid participants. The popularity of fantasy sports is skyrocketing, which is causing enthusiasts to experience an adrenaline rush. According to analyst predictions, the worldwide fantasy sports market would expand at a CAGR of around 12% through 2022.

FANTASY SPORTS MARKET: A BRIEF OVERVIEW

The professional league industry used to be very conservative when it came to fantasy sports in the beginning. However, company culture has recently evolved and is now more hospitable and tolerant. Legal authorities previously rejected the emergence of DFS leagues because they believed that such practices abused players by giving them access to assets. However, due to their great appeal, professional leagues have paved the door for a range of daily fantasy and professional league collaborations. The market for fantasy sports is anticipated to surpass $1.5 billion by 2024, with a CAGR of more than 11% over that period.
